Understanding Typical Medical Assistant Work Hours

Standard Schedules in ​Medical assisting

Most medical assistants work in clinical or ‌administrative settings,including‌ hospitals,clinics,private practices,and outpatient care centers. The ​hours they keep can vary widely based on the employer,⁤ setting,⁣ and specific role.

Schedule Type Typical Hours Examples of Settings
Regular Business Hours 8:00 ⁢AM‌ – 5:00 PM, Monday-Friday Doctor’s offices, outpatient⁢ clinics
Extended Hours 7:00 AM – 7:00 PM, sometimes weekends Urgent care, urgent care ‌clinics, hospitals
Part-Time Shifts Varies, ⁤often less than 30 hours/week Specialty clinics, temporary roles

Shift Flexibility and Variations

Medical assistants often ⁣experience diverse work hours based on the practise’s ‌needs. Some common variations include:

  • Day Shifts: Typical ‌hours from⁤ morning to‍ late afternoon.
  • Evening/Shifts: Especially in urgent care or 24-hour facilities.
  • Weekends and Holidays: Required‌ in certain settings, which can affect personal plans.
  • On-Call or Rotating‍ Shifts: Less common but present​ in hospitals and emergency care settings.

How Work Hours Impact Your‌ Medical‌ Assistant Career

Influence on Professional Growth

Your ⁣work schedule can influence your career trajectory in several ways:

  • Skills Growth: Working in high-demand hours, such as evenings and weekends, may expose you to a more diverse patient population.
  • Networking Opportunities: Extended or flexible⁣ hours can connect you wiht ⁣different teams and professionals.
  • Career Advancement: Demonstrating flexibility and⁣ commitment can definitely help you ​move⁣ into supervisory or specialized ⁣roles.

Work-Life ​balance Considerations

Adapting to irregular ‍or demanding work hours can impact your personal life. It’s essential to evaluate​ how ⁣your ​schedule aligns‌ with your lifestyle and responsibilities:

  • Consistent daytime hours‍ generally allow better personal planning.
  • Evening and weekend shifts may interfere with ‍family or ⁣social⁢ activities.
  • Part-time roles can offer greater flexibility but⁢ might influence income levels.

Salary and compensation⁢ Factors

Often, ⁤working outside of regular daytime‍ hours can come with increased pay:

  • Overtime pay for extra hours worked.
  • Shift differentials ​for evenings, ⁤nights, or weekend shifts.

Real-Life Case Studies: Medical⁢ Assistant Schedules ‍in Action

Case Study 1: ⁤Sarah’s Daytime Routine

Sarah works at a family practice clinic from ​8:00 AM to 4:30 PM, Monday through Friday. ⁢Her consistent schedule allows her to enjoy evenings⁤ and weekends ⁣with her family, contributing to a healthy work-life balance and steady career advancement.

Case Study 2: Mike’s​ Evening Shifts

Mike⁤ is employed at an urgent care center,⁢ working 4:00 PM to 12:00 AM. While his ‌hours are unconventional, he appreciates the higher pay rate and the prospect to​ gain diverse experience in a fast-paced environment.

Licensing and Certification

Most employers prefer certified medical assistants,which can influence scheduling flexibility and opportunities​ for overtime or specialized‌ hours. Certifications like the CMA (Certified Medical Assistant) or RMA (Registered Medical Assistant) can open doors to ‌different work⁤ hours.
